This work presents an unsupervised and semi-automatic image segmentation approach where we formulate the segmentation as a inference problem based on unary and pairwise assignment probabilities computed using low-level image cues. The inference is solved via a probabilistic graph matching scheme, which allows rigorous incorporation of low level image cues and automatic tuning of parameters. The proposed scheme is experimentally shown to compare favorably with contemporary semi-supervised and unsupervised image segmentation schemes, when applied to contemporary state-of-the-art image sets.
